node.js - “Error: Please install pg package manually” 尝试运行 “npm run serve:dev” 时?

标签 node.js postgresql networking npm pg

我正在尝试使用脚本 npm run serve:dev 运行一个应用程序 但在尝试运行 npm run serve:dev

时出现错误 Error: Please install pg package manually

我已经尝试过 npm install -g pg','npm install -g pg-hstore

错误:

kshitij-mag@0.1.0 serve:dev /home/qroach/kshitij-mag nodemon --ignore './src/' --exec babel-node --presets babel-preset-env ./server/bin/www

[nodemon] 1.18.10 [nodemon] to restart at any time, enter rs [nodemon] watching: . [nodemon] starting babel-node --presets babel-preset-env ./server/bin/www /home/qroach/node_modules/sequelize/lib/dialects/abstract/connection-manager.js:81 throw new Error(Please install ${moduleName} package manually); ^

Error: Please install pg package manually at ConnectionManager._loadDialectModule (/home/qroach/node_modules/sequelize/lib/dialects/abstract/connection-manager.js:81:15) at new ConnectionManager (/home/qroach/node_modules/sequelize/lib/dialects/postgres/connection-manager.js:18:24) at new PostgresDialect (/home/qroach/node_modules/sequelize/lib/dialects/postgres/index.js:14:30) at new Sequelize (/home/qroach/node_modules/sequelize/lib/sequelize.js:241:20) at Object. (/home/qroach/kshitij-mag/server/db/models/index.js:16:15) at Module._compile (internal/modules/cjs/loader.js:799:30) at loader (/usr/lib/node_modules/babel-cli/node_modules/babel-register/lib/node.js:144:5) at Object.require.extensions.(anonymous function) [as .js] (/usr/lib/node_modules/babel-cli/node_modules/babel-register/lib/node.js:154:7) at Module.load (internal/modules/cjs/loader.js:666:32) at tryModuleLoad (internal/modules/cjs/loader.js:606:12) at Function.Module._load (internal/modules/cjs/loader.js:598:3) at Module.require (internal/modules/cjs/loader.js:705:19) at require (internal/modules/cjs/helpers.js:14:16) at Object. (/home/qroach/kshitij-mag/server/controllers/AuthController.js:2:1) at Module._compile (internal/modules/cjs/loader.js:799:30) at loader (/usr/lib/node_modules/babel-cli/node_modules/babel-register/lib/node.js:144:5) at Object.require.extensions.(anonymous function) [as .js] (/usr/lib/node_modules/babel-cli/node_modules/babel-register/lib/node.js:154:7) at Module.load (internal/modules/cjs/loader.js:666:32) at tryModuleLoad (internal/modules/cjs/loader.js:606:12) at Function.Module._load (internal/modules/cjs/loader.js:598:3) at Module.require (internal/modules/cjs/loader.js:705:19) at require (internal/modules/cjs/helpers.js:14:16) [nodemon] app crashed - waiting for file changes before starting...

我希望它可以使用脚本运行,但它只是给出了这个错误。

最佳答案

本地安装

npm install pg --save

关于node.js - “Error: Please install pg package manually” 尝试运行 “npm run serve:dev” 时?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/55340843/

相关文章:

c++ - TCP端口访问和C++

networking - 在 omnetpp 中找不到类 "simpleModule"

javascript - 在急切加载期间,错误 : Tried to select attributes using Sequelize. 强制转换或 Sequelize.fn 未指定结果别名

node.js - 当我需要 aws-sdk 模块时 AWS Lambda 函数超时

javascript - 如何检测 ES Module 是否是主模块?

ruby-on-rails - 索引同时未显示在 structure.sql 中

php - 如何在 PHP 中获取用户输入日期以在 PostgreSQL 语句的 where 子句中使用?

ruby-on-rails - Rails (Activerecord) - 无法使用没有重复的连接和全局总和进行查询

ios - 仅通过Wifi测试iOS连接

node.js - 如何在 Hyperledger 1.4.4 的 Node.js 中使用 setTransient 和 getTransient(示例)?